How to Recover Points on Your Driving License

New York allows drivers who complete defensive driving courses approved by the state to eliminate points from their driving records. These programs do not remove convictions from your driving abstract but they do reduce the number of points.

If you score 11 or more points in the span of 18 months, your license and right to drive could be suspended. It is crucial to engage a lawyer and fight traffic tickets.

Learn defensive driving

In addition to reducing the points on your driving license, taking defensive driving classes may also qualify you for a discount on your car insurance. Many insurance companies offer safe driver incentive programs that can reduce your risk and collision premium by up to 10 percent. Speak to your agent to learn about your options, including whether you can take a New York State approved defensive driving course in a classroom or on the internet.

Defensive driving classes are designed to teach drivers strategies to help them avoid accidents, and also manage dangerous road conditions and other drivers. They cover topics like how to recognize and respond to aggressive drivers as well as the importance of keeping a safe distance to follow and how to prepare for and react to roadway emergencies. The course can help you become a confident driver and may even save your life as well as the lives of others on the road.

Seek Legal Representation

A traffic ticket can have serious consequences on your driving privileges. A New York City traffic attorney can assist you in reducing the long-term effects of your ticket, regardless of whether you have points on license or face a possible Suspension du permis De conduire et permis retiré.

While you can avoid many tickets by not speeding, it's impossible to completely prevent all traffic violations. Even a minor ticket for speeding could result in points being added to your record and can result in an increase in your insurance rates.

The method by which points are assigned and evaluated the way in which points are allocated and assessed differs from state to state. The Department of Motor Vehicles in your state typically assigns a certain number of penalties for each violation. These points are recorded on your record after you've been found guilty. Once the number of points reaches a specific threshold, your DMV could suspend your license.

You can lower your points by taking a driving course which is approved by your DMV. This option allows you to eliminate four points in the majority of instances. You can only take part in driver's improvement courses every 18-months.

Another option to avoid accruing points is to challenge the ticket itself in court. A New York traffic lawyer with experience can bargain with judges or prosecutors to reduce the charges, or even to have them dismissed.

Take a 6-Hour New York State Driver Safety Class

A high number of points on your driving record could be a serious issue with regards to your insurance rates for cars. In certain instances, it can even cause your license to be suspended or revoked. In New York, you can recover your driving points in various ways.

New York State offers a 6-hour program known as the Point and Insurance Reduction Program to help drivers meet certain eligibility requirements and reduce their total points. Completion of the class will stop the DMV from calculating up to four points on your record in the process of assessing penalties or license suspension. These points remain on your record but will not be used to calculate penalties or suspend your license.

The DMV has granted private companies the right to offer the PIRP course which teaches defensive driving techniques. The course covers topics such as attitudes and behavior of drivers, vehicle safety and driving laws. The duration of classes is usually between six and nine hours. The cost of a course may differ from company to company and is based on a variety of factors, including the materials provided to the students, the methodology used in the class, and also the company.

You could be able to lower your auto insurance rate by taking a PIRP class. The insurance company can include the credits in the policy for a period of three years. You can look through quotes to find the most competitive rate.

It is important to be aware that a PIRP will only erase the points from your driving record if they were accumulated within the last 18 month. It will not stop the DMV from imposing additional penalties or increasing your insurance rates in the future due to violations. The only way to keep points off your record for longer than that is to fight the traffic ticket in court and successfully have it dismissed.
